Understanding HVAC Maintenance Services
So, what exactly do HVAC maintenance services involve? At their core, these services are all about making sure your system is running smoothly. A typical maintenance visit can include inspections, cleanings, and some key adjustments that keep everything in check.
1. Inspections: Technicians will look over the key components of your HVAC system, such as the motors and electrical connections, to catch any potential issues before they become bigger problems.
2. Cleanings: Dirt and debris can slow down your system and make it work harder than it needs to. Cleanings involve scrubbing down parts like coils and changing air filters to improve airflow and efficiency.
3. Adjustments and Minor Repairs: Sometimes, all that’s needed are small tweaks to keep things running smoothly. Technicians might make simple adjustments or minor repairs to ensure everything is in its best working order.
Regular maintenance services like these don’t just prevent unwanted surprises; they help your HVAC system work efficiently and effectively year-round, providing peace of mind. Maintaining a regular schedule creates a balanced environment that your system thrives on, much like maintaining a consistent routine in other areas of life. By keeping up with these routine tasks, you ensure your HVAC system is always ready to take on the changing seasons with ease.

How Often Should You Schedule HVAC Maintenance?
Knowing when to schedule HVAC maintenance is key to keeping your system in top shape. Generally, having a professional look at your system twice a year is a good rule of thumb. Many homeowners find that a spring check-up is ideal for air conditioning, and a fall appointment gets the heating ready for colder weather.
Seasonal considerations can play a significant role in your maintenance schedule. For example, if you live in a place with hot summers, ensuring your AC is ready before the heat kicks in is a smart move. Similarly, if winters are harsh, making sure your furnace is in excellent shape before the cold hits can save you from discomfort.
Regular maintenance visits provide ample opportunities to catch things early, much like scheduling regular dentist appointments to keep your teeth healthy. It ensures your system is always ready to handle the demands of the upcoming season.
Tips for Choosing a Reliable HVAC Maintenance Service Provider
When it’s time to hire a professional for HVAC maintenance, picking the right service provider is crucial. Here are some tips to help you choose wisely:
– Check for Certification and Experience: Look for technicians with the right credentials and ample experience. This ensures you get someone who knows what they’re doing.
– Ask for References or Reviews: Hearing from other customers can give you insight into the quality and reliability of the service.
– Verify Licensing and Insurance: A reputable provider will be fully licensed and insured. This protects you in case of any mishaps during maintenance.
– Inquire About Service Options and Pricing: Make sure they offer comprehensive services and check if their pricing fits your budget.
Finding a trustworthy HVAC service provider ensures peace of mind, knowing your system is in good hands. Remember to ask questions and trust your instincts when making a final decision.
